Kevin Correia 2011 Topps All-Star Game Jersey (red)
Correia was signed as a free agent prior to the 2011 season.  He earned his first All-Star game trip due to being one of the NL's leaders in wins.  After the All-Star break, Correia would go on to win only 1 more game and was shut down in August with an injury.
John Van Benschoten Topps 52 AUTO
JVB was one of colleges top hitters prior to the 2001 draft.  He lead the NCAA division 1-A in HR, but was converted to a pitcher by the Pirates.  He currently has one of the highest career ERA in MLB history.
